Competition Details
The Brașov O-Meeting, now in its third edition, is a significant event in Romania’s orienteering calendar. In this edition, the competition includes four stages (Prologue, Sprint, Middle & Long – Pursuit). Two stages are part of the World Ranking Event (WRE), featuring a Sprint race in Râșnov city and a Middle Distance race in Săcele – Vălășoaia. The first stage is a Middle Distance – Prologue in Vulcan and the final stage is a Long Distance – Pursuit race, in Râșnov, adding an extra layer of strategy and endurance to the competition.

Middle WRE
Event Center Casa Vălășoaia Săcele
Terrain: Moderately hilly forested area with gentle slopes.
Vegetation: Dense pine forest with a few clearings.
Runnability and Visibility: Moderate to low, due to dense vegetation.
Paths and Roads: Forest roads and narrow trails, some unmarked.
Altitude: Situated at approximately 600–700 m above sea level.
Long
Event center: Râșnov
Altitude: ~600–960 m above sea level, increasing toward the surrounding hills and forests.
Terrain: Hilly terrain, with moderate slopes and occasional steep sections along the ridges.
Vegetation: Mixed forest (mainly deciduous, with some coniferous areas); vegetation density varies.
Runnability and Visibility: Moderate to low; open forest areas allow efficient movement, while dense sections reduce visibility and speed.
Paths and Roads: Sparse forest trails, logging roads, and occasional tracks; some areas have no paths.
Prolog
Event center: Vulcan
Altitude: ~650–950 m above sea level, gradually increasing toward the surrounding forested hills.
Terrain: Moderately hilly terrain, with gentle slopes and some steeper sections along the ridges.
Vegetation: Mixed forest, predominantly deciduous, with scattered conifers; vegetation density varies.
Runnability and Visibility: Moderate to low — open forest areas are relatively runnable, while dense sections reduce speed and visibility.
Paths and Roads: Limited network of forest trails and old logging roads; some areas require navigation off-trail.

Timing System
The electronic timing system Sportident will be used. Competitors with a standard Sportident card will check in as usual, while SIAC users will be able to use the contactless system.
Sportident Card
Rental SI cards are available at no additional cost for participants who do not have their own chip. The fee for a lost Sportident card is €80.
Live Results
Online live results will be available, and the overall results will be published on the website after the final stage.

Award ceremony
The WRE categories will be awarded at the end of each competition day, with prizes for the top 6 positions. The BVOM awards ceremony will take place on Sunday, and the rankings will combine the results of the three stages (the prologue will not be included in the cumulative ranking). The top three competitors in each category will be awarded.

Travel
Airport
București Henri Coandă
The distance between Henri Coandă Airport (Otopeni) and Brașov is approximately 160 kilometers. There are several options for traveling from the airport to Brașov:
By Car: You can rent a car at the airport and drive to Brașov. The journey takes about 2-3 hours, depending on traffic and weather conditions. It is recommended to use a navigation app like Waze to choose the fastest route, as this is one of the busiest roads in Romania.
By Train: From the airport, you can take a train to Gara de Nord in Bucharest (about 20-30 minutes). From Gara de Nord, you can take a direct train to Brașov. The Intercity (IC) and InterRegio (IR) trains are the fastest and most comfortable, with a journey time of approximately 2-3 hours.
Transfer Services: Another convenient option is to use transfer services that offer direct transport from Henri Coandă Airport to Brașov.

Brașov Ghimbav
Brașov-Ghimbav International Airport (AIBG) is located approximately 12 kilometers from the center of Brașov. Here are some options for traveling from Ghimbav Airport to Brașov:
Taxi
Availability: Taxis are available at the airport and are one of the most convenient transportation methods. The journey takes about 20-30 minutes, depending on traffic. Cost: Fares can vary, but generally range around 40-60 lei.
